Top Security Tips
Stay Safe
Avoid using DocLocker or other critical services such as Internet Banking at Internet Cafes, Libraries, and other public sites. If such public sites are not secure, your critical passwords and information could be copied and abused
Lock it, Don’t Print it
Don’t print unnecessary copies of your critical information if not needed. Keep track of all hard copies – think about your document security before clicking print
Keep your Computer Secure
Secure your computer by installing anti-virus and anti-spyware software, using a unique password, securing your unique password, and regularly checking for security updates

Be Aware of Online Fraud
Phoney websites designed to trick you and collect your critical information are a reality. Links to such websites are contained in email messages claiming to come from a legitimate organisation. Try not to click website links from an email - always enter the known web address in your web browser to link to critical sites such as DocLocker or your Internet Banking websites
Regularly Change your Passwords
Change your passwords at least every 3 months. DocLocker recommends you change your password every 6 weeks

Protect your Computer with a Password
Use a password on your computer to prevent individuals from accessing your information
Disable the ‘AutoComplete’ Function Within your Browser
The ‘AutoComplete’ function remembers data you have entered – this can include passwords. Your web browser’s Help function will show you how to disable the ‘AutoComplete’ function, to prevent others from seeing your personal information
Only Provide Bank Information During Secure Sessions
Always purchase online during secure transaction sessions. During any purchase process, look for secure purchase information that should be displayed on screen. If in doubt, don’t purchase
Never Send Sensitive Information by Email
Information included in an email is at risk of being intercepted by unauthorised individuals. Keep your information secure in your DocLocker
Be Wary of Opening Unexpected Emails with Attachments
Viruses are commonly spread via emails, which can send copies of themselves to everyone in an infected computer’s address book. This means it could appear from someone you know. Never open an email attachment that contains a file ending with .exe, .pif, .vbs as these are commonly used with viruses. Any file that appears to have a double extension is almost certainly a virus and should be deleted immediately.
Passwords
Passwords are critical to securing your online accounts. Here we give you a few simple tips to keep you protected:
Never Share or Write Down your Password
Never write down or share your password with anyone, no matter how well you may know them. Do not send your password via email, text message or fax
Be Unique and Never Personal
Try and create passwords that are unique and not easy to guess – avoid using personal passwords that are easily guessed such as partner’s names, children’s names, pet’s names or birth dates
Use Letters, Numbers and Symbols
Passwords containing upper and lower case letters, numbers and symbols are far harder to guess than complete words. Never use complete words – especially words that can be found in the dictionary.
